通过石墨烯的电子化学潜力选择表面合成的反应路径

在石墨烯上的有机金属合成产生了不同的稀土元素产物. N-doping 石墨烯可以调整反应以形成分子线而不是点.

背景情况:
- 在表面合成提供精确的分子组装控制.
- 稀土元素 (兰坦化物) 具有与催化和电子相关的独特电子特性.
- 石墨烯作为表面反应的多功能二维基材.
研究的目的:
- 在石墨烯 (Gr) 上研究 (Yb) 和 (Tm) 的有机金属合成.
- 探索基质兴奋剂如何影响反应结果和产品结构.
- 了解YbCot和TmCot结构形成的基本相互作用.
主要方法:
- 在石墨烯表面合成有机金属.
- 使用扫描探针显微镜进行表征 (隐含).
- 密度函数理论 (DFT) 的计算.
主要成果:
- Yb合成产生长的三明治分子YbCot线由范德瓦尔斯力结合.
- Tm合成最初形成了TmCot点,被化学吸附到石墨烯中.
- N-doping 石墨烯可以将TmCot点转化为TmCot三明治分子线.
- DFT证实n-doping会削弱基质结合和电荷转移,有利于电线形成.
结论:
- 通过控制基质的电子性质,可以调整有机金属表面合成的结果.
- 石墨烯的电子化学潜力是指导反应途径的关键参数.
- 这项工作展示了一种控制稀土金属有机复合物的方法.
